A diploid cell with 2n = 8 undergoes meiosis. Number of chromosomes in each daughter cell after meiosis II completion:
A4 (haploid, n)
B2
C8
D16
Answer & Solution
Correct answer: A. 4 (haploid, n)
2n = 8 → n = 4. Meiosis I: reduces to 4 chromosomes per cell (each with 2 chromatids). Meiosis II: separates sister chromatids → each daughter has 4 chromosomes (1 chromatid each). 4 haploid cells per diploid starting cell.
